From Fox News: Oscar-winning actor Gene Hackman was found dead alongside his wife, classical pianist Betsy Arakawa, and their dog in their Santa Fe home on Wednesday afternoon.

Hackman was 95 at the time of his death, and his wife 63. The office confirmed that foul play is not suspected as a factor in the deaths at this time, but the cause of death has not been determined. An investigation is ongoing.

“On February 26, 2025, at approximately 1:45 p.m., Santa Fe County Sheriff’s deputies were dispatched to an address on Old Sunset Trail in Hyde Park, where Gene Hackman, 95 and his wife Betsy Arakawa, 64, and a dog were found deceased,” the Santa Fe County Sheriff’s office told Fox News Digital early Thursday morning.

Hackman was best known for his Oscar-winning performances in “The French Connection” and “Unforgiven.” He appeared as villains, heroes and antiheroes in dozens of dramas, comedies and action films from the 1960s until his retirement in the early 2000s.


UPDATE: Fox News later shared additional details:

Santa Fe County Sheriff Adan Mendoza confirmed with Fox News Digital that a search warrant showed Hackman, his wife and their dog had been dead for some time. Mendoza said their team found the deceased dog in a kennel during the investigation. The couple’s bodies were in different rooms when deputies found them while conducting a wellness check at their Santa Fe home.

On Wednesday, Hackman was found dead in a mudroom and his wife, Arakawa, was found dead in a bathroom next to a space heater. There was an open prescription bottle and pills scattered on the countertop near Arakawa.
